Getting Started with NA in Baldwin

Attending your first NA meeting in Baldwin, Iowa can feel overwhelming, but you'll quickly discover that everyone there was once a newcomer too. Members of NA often go out of their way to welcome new people and make them feel at ease.

You don't need to call ahead, sign up, or pay anything to attend an NA meeting. Just show up. There are no forms to fill out and no commitment required. Many people try several different meetings before finding one that feels right.

If you're nervous about your first meeting, consider arriving a few minutes early. This gives you a chance to meet some members in a smaller setting before the meeting begins. You can also bring a friend or family member to an open meeting for moral support.

Can I attend NA in Baldwin, Iowa if I am on medication-assisted treatment?

You are welcome. Meetings in Baldwin, Iowa do not turn anyone away, and decisions about prescribed medication are between you and your doctor. The fellowship across the Jackson area focuses on offering support, not judging your medical care.

What does Narcotics Anonymous offer people in Baldwin, Iowa?

Narcotics Anonymous is a nonprofit fellowship of people for whom drugs had become a major problem. Members at NA meetings in Baldwin, Iowa meet regularly to help each other stay clean from all drugs, with no dues and no outside affiliations.

How long do NA meetings in Baldwin, Iowa last?

Plan for roughly 60 to 90 minutes. Meetings in Baldwin, Iowa usually run about an hour, with speaker and step study formats sometimes lasting longer. Arriving a few minutes early gives you time to settle in.

What program of recovery is followed at Baldwin, Iowa meetings?

The Twelve Steps are a set of guiding principles for recovery. Members at meetings in Baldwin, Iowa work them with a sponsor to address the physical, mental, and spiritual aspects of addiction. The steps form the core of the NA program.

What does "clean time" mean at NA meetings in Baldwin, Iowa?

Clean time counts from the last day you used any drug, including alcohol. The fellowship in Baldwin, Iowa marks these milestones with keytags, and members across the Jackson area celebrate one another's progress.
